## Step 3 — Schema parsing (the canonical rules other skills delegate to)

Parse the schema into `Fields`. Always strip system fields (`id`, `created_at`/`createdAt`, `updated_at`/`updatedAt`) — they are injected.

**Type mapping** (SQL / JSON / OAS → TS domain · TypeBox · Drizzle column):

| Source | TS type | TypeBox | Drizzle |
|---|---|---|---|
| VARCHAR/TEXT/CHAR/string | `string` | `t.String()` | `varchar`/`text` |
| INT/INTEGER/number(int) | `number` | `t.Integer()` | `integer` |
| BIGINT | `number` | `t.Integer()` | `bigint({mode:'number'})` |
| FLOAT/DOUBLE/DECIMAL/number(float) | `number` | `t.Number()` | `doublePrecision` |
| BOOLEAN/BOOL/TINYINT(1) | `boolean` | `t.Boolean()` | `boolean` |
| TIMESTAMP/DATETIME/date-time | `Date` | `t.String({format:'date-time'})` | `bigint({mode:'number'})` |
| UUID | `string` | `t.String({format:'uuid'})` | `varchar` |

**Nullable** (NULL / `nullable:true` / not in `required`): TS type `T | null`; Drizzle drops `.notNull()`.

**FieldDef** (used by the templates): `.Name` (camelCase), `.GoType` (TS type string incl. `| null`), `.JSONName` (snake_case wire), `.DBColumn` (snake_case), `.Validate` (`required` / `required,max=N` / ``). The name `GoType` is kept so the Params shape matches the renderer's `FieldDef`.

**System fields** (always injected): `id` (`string`, varchar(36) PK), `createdAt`/`updatedAt` (`Date` domain, `bigint` epoch-ms column). The repository maps `bigint(string from driver) → Number → Date`.

## Step 4 — Apperr base offset

Before generating `src/apperr/{entityLower}.ts`, scan existing `src/apperr/*.ts` for `BASE = N`. Set `ApperrBase` = highest N + 1000, default 1000. Prevents code collisions.

### Key patterns enforced by the templates
- The repository implements the domain-typed `port.{Entity}Repository`, internally wrapping `repo.BaseRepo`/`CachedRepo` over a snake_case `{Entity}Row` + a `ModelMeta` (Drizzle 0.38 has no runtime reflection).
- `toDomain`/`toRow` map row↔domain; **Date fields coerce `new Date(Number(col))`** (Postgres bigint arrives as a string).
- `mapRepoErr` maps `repo.ErrNotFound` → `new ApiError(Err{Entity}NotFound)`.
- `update` passes an explicit column list (never clobbers `id`/`created_at`).
- `newCached{Entity}Repository` is emitted only when `cache != none`; the key prefix is owned by `makeCachedRepository` (no double-prefix on the backend).
